FCOM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

143 of the 6,859 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Fidelity MSCI Communication Services Index ETF (FCOM)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$501M — up 16% from $432M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 29 funds opened new FCOM positions and 13 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 41 added to existing stakes and 52 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Northwestern Mutual Wealth Management, adding an estimated $17.5M. The largest seller was Beaumont Capital Management, cutting an estimated $7.34M.
